Back to Blog
team@tinypod.app

Self-Hosting Open WebUI: Chat Interface for Local AI

Open WebUI is a ChatGPT-like interface for Ollama and other local AI models. Beautiful UI, conversation history, and RAG support.

open-webuiaillmchat

What Is Open WebUI?


Open WebUI (formerly Ollama WebUI) is a ChatGPT-like interface for local AI models. Connect to Ollama or any OpenAI-compatible API.


Features


  • ChatGPT-like conversation UI
  • Conversation history
  • Multiple model selection
  • System prompts and personas
  • RAG (upload documents for context)
  • Image generation
  • Voice input/output
  • Model management
  • User management
  • Mobile-friendly
  • Plugin system

  • Open WebUI vs Lobe Chat vs Text Generation WebUI


  • Open WebUI: Best overall UI, most features
  • Lobe Chat: Best design, plugin marketplace
  • Text Generation WebUI: Most technical, model loading options

  • Deployment


    1. Deploy Ollama (runs models)

    2. Deploy Open WebUI (provides the interface)

    3. Select a model

    4. Chat


    Resources: 1 CPU, 512 MB RAM (plus Ollama resources).


    Open WebUI is the best way to interact with local AI models.